About this property

Econo Lodge

Econo Lodge puts you within a 15-minute drive of Texas A&M University - College Station and Kyle Field. Guests can visit the fitness centre for a workout, and free perks include WiFi, self-parking and continental breakfast daily between 6:00 AM and 9:00 AM.
